Unfortunately, I don't think this is going to fix your board. The normal symptom is, the left and right main outputs mute at random times, caused by an overly sensitive on/off transient suppression circuit. The fix for this was implemented in to our factory production in Feb of 2011.
Your problem, sounds more like worn or broken faders, but it is hard to tell without actually seeing the mixer.
I would still recommend performing this modification, if it's not already on your board. I can email you the mod and you can compare it to what you have.
